The rise of vaping has transformed the landscape of nicotine consumption, offering an alternative to traditional smoking. Central to this evolution has been the development of atomizers, which play a crucial role in vaporization. To understand the current state of vaping and its devices, it is essential to explore the history of atomizers since 2011.
Vaping gained significant popularity in the early 2010s, primarily due to rising health concerns associated with smoking. In 2011, the vaping market was still in its infancy, characterized by rudimentary devices and basic atomizers. Early atomizers were primarily made of metal and glass, with simple wicks that fed e-liquid to a coil. Although these initial designs were functional, they lacked efficiency and flavor quality.
As the years progressed, innovative designs began to emerge, driven by the increasing demand for more efficient and enjoyable vaping experiences. The introduction of sub-ohm tanks in 2014 revolutionized the industry by allowing users to vape at lower resistance levels, resulting in increased vapor production and enhanced flavor. This innovation marked a turning point, as manufacturers began to focus on improving atomizer technology.
By 2015, the development of rebuildable atomizers (RDA) and rebuildable tank atomizers (RTA) offered seasoned vapers greater control over their setups. These devices allowed users to customize their coils and wicking materials, catering to individual preferences for vapor quality and flavor intensity. The DIY aspect of RDAs and RTAs contributed to a burgeoning community of enthusiasts who shared techniques and experiences online, fostering a culture around vaping.
In the following years, the introduction of temperature control technology and regulated devices further enhanced the vaping experience. Temperature control atomizers provided users with the ability to set specific temperatures for their coils, preventing dry hits and improving overall safety. This advancement demonstrated the industry’s commitment to user satisfaction and safety.
By 2020, the market had matured significantly, with a wide variety of atomizers catering to different vaping styles and preferences. Today, vapers can choose from a plethora of options ranging from mouth-to-lung (MTL) devices for a tighter draw to direct-to-lung (DTL) devices for cloud chasing. The atomizer industry has not only expanded in variety but has also seen enhancements in design, safety features, and materials, such as the use of advanced ceramics and stainless steel.
